London Diving Chamber will once again be hosting the Dive Lectures at the RGS (Royal Geographical Society) following last year’s success. This year’s speakers will include: Monty Halls, Leigh Bishop and Loyd Grossman. The event is held in support of Scuba Trust - a charity devoted to giving people with physical disabilities an equal opportunity to experience the pleasure and excitement of scuba diving and the underwater world.
Date: Thursday 2nd February
Time: 6.30pm
Location: RGS, Kensington Gore, SW7 2AR
Registration is free, but numbers are limited.
